Output 5ab230d52ef81fa4b848058a590d84e7811ee3290c96fe43ef0ed9868085624d:1

value
44380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6d06ea22bfd94c88f13a137aac99a2025ed191 OP_EQUAL
address
A54CXC5VL7FExYgFnKecw1rkty1JWXLRtS
transaction
5ab230d52ef81fa4b848058a590d84e7811ee3290c96fe43ef0ed9868085624d